My trigger? I would have many triggers. I found the weekends the worst, still are, it makes me want to eat, then i can't stop. But, what seems to be the "trigger" is the carb creep. I would do well for weeks and weeks, had been clean for years, then i would add some foods back in, up the carbs. Never grains. But, fruit. Fruit, that was always the start.
I would be fine on berries, but add anything else. OMG I ate a 3 lbs bag of cuties. Then I would move on to something else with the logic that its not as bad as cake, or something like that. Then, on to more fruit, then stuff thats not really legal. Canned fruit in heavy syrup. I'd move onto peanut butter, then all was lost. I start on the "fringes" of what is legal, then slowly it busts wide open.
Lc eating is the only way i have been able to control my eating and cravings. I also am a huge emotional eater, stress, sadness, etc. That has helped trigger binging the last couple years. I would eat the legal foods and still not feel "fulfilled" even though i wasn't hungry. I was looking for the comfort.
